Q. How is comics blending with Music ? Gaming? Film? and where do you see it going?

Comics have always crossed over to other media. From the George Reeves Superman tv show, all the way to The Man of Steel film with Henry Cavill to the current Marvel show Echo, I think it will continue to do so as more classic stories get adapted to film and tv. New voices will keep these characters fresh and current, which is important in gaining new fans to comics.

Because streaming is dominating the media markets from Amazon to Disney to Hulu to Netflix and HBO, there is a tremendous opportunity for comic book stories to thrive in "new television" and "adaptive films". This gives way for a growth of stories, artists and writers.

Gaming and comics go hand in hand. We see this crossover in our store and at major events such as #Comic-con and others. Games - from character based board games to console to online games and multiplayer utilize comic book and graphic novel stories frequently for their development. 

In all of this is music. Music is the centerpiece of what brings the cross-media alive. I know Jasmine, you know all about this as JSM for Artists started with supporting the needs of struggling musicians and has expanded to all artists as we both see this crossover exploding!

Q. What are you the most excited about when it comes to the future of the comic book business ?

I am excited to see what the big two (Marvel and DC Comics) and beyond have in store for us. I think that they will continue to think outside the box and procure the attention of new and old fans by creating new storylines that capture our minds. I'm also looking forward to the many independent projects by the seasoned pros as they jump back and forth from the big two, to their own projects. We also love that because we can get them in the store for signings!

And let's not forget about what just happened tonight in our store! We had a legendary hero in heavy metal music and now a long-time comic book story writer here in our downtown location - Bruce Dickinson of Iron Maiden, signing his new book "Mandrake" with artists and published by our friends at Z2Comics, which aligns with his first solo album in 10 years in the same name. When I tell you , Jasmine, that fans were waiting in 20 degree weather from 8am until now (7pm) I am seriously not kidding. The opportunity for celebs cross-media to now get involved, support and thrive in our (comic book) industry is so exciting! This tells me we (Midtown and the comic book industry itself) are in the right place at the right time!

MIDTOWN COMICS opened its first store in 1997, and is now the industry’s leading retailer of comic books, graphic novels, and manga, with its online store in addition to four NYC locations in Times Square, Grand Central, Downtown, & Astoria, Queens.
